So what sets VSCO Cam apart from the likes of Instagram, Pixlr Express, and FxCamera is the focus of the photo-editing app itself. While other apps attempt to enhance and define your photos - especially smoothing the skin, changing the skin-tone, adding effects here and there to accomplish that, VSCO Cam aims to compliment your photos.
VSCO Cam not only allows you to add effects to your photo's, it gives you the flexibility to fine-tune the effect so that the details that you captured does not get lost. Exposure, Temperature, Contrast, Crop, Rotate, Fade, Vignette and more can be individually controlled and adjusted to fit the look you are trying to accomplish.
The interface is sleek and simple - no overwhelming nests of menus and options cluttering the screen - no messy buttons to press and no confusing or misleading texts - just simple icons and precision sliders. And if you worry about losing the capability to share you photos on Facebook or Twitter, fret not - these features are also available in VSCO Cam.
